Re: Cambiar una variable de entorno por script
"Ricardo Frydman Eureka!" wrote:
>
> -----BEGIN PGP SIGNED MESSAGE-----
> Hash: SHA1
>
> Cherny Berbesi wrote:
> > Hola amigos,
>
> Hola, por favor ni uses HTML esta /mal/ visto aqui!
> > estoy tranto de hacer un script que me permita cambiar la
> > direccion actual del shell en el sistema de archivo.
>
> Que te permita hacer que cosa?
>
> > Esto es lo que hice:
> >
> > #!/bin/bash
> > export ORACLE_HOME=/opt/oracle/infra10g
> > export ORACLE_SID=asdb
> > cd $ORACLE_HOME/bin
> > #End script
> >
> > donde esta la linea cd $ORACLE_HOME/bin quiero que en el shell quede en
> > ese directorio
>
> Cual shell?
>
> >
> > Me di cuenta de que la variable PDW guarda la posicion actual del shell
> > pero con seguridad no estoy haciendo lo correcto...
>
> Sinceramente no entiendo que deseas hacer.Intentarias explicarlo?
>
Yo tampoco entiendo muy bien la pregunta.
Pero creo que lo que quieres es hacer un script que te cambie
el entorno actual.
Si lo ejecutas normalmente, te creará un subshell y modificará
el entorno de ese subshell, para evitar esto debes ejecutarlo
poniento un punto delante " kkk$ . ./miScript.sh"
o usando el comando interno de bash "source"
Saludos.
--
Fernando.
{:-{D>
"Hackers do it with fewer instructions."
Reply to: